    Some trivia I know about this band: the drummer is dressed as a yakuza member, the singer/guitarist is dressed as a literature teacher, and the bassist is a Buddhist monk who guards graveyards. In Asian cultures, white is the color of death and sorrow rather than black, that's why his face is painted in white.
    The name "Ningen Isu" means "Human Chair" which is very famous classical Japanese novel. I didn't read it but I read Junji Itou's manga adaptation of it. Basically, a guy is in love with a woman who writes novels, so he lives inside her favorite chair to stalk her and watch every detail of her life. He sends her letters about how he enjoys watching her as well. He kills her husband later, and she, out of desperation, confusion, and loneliness, starts living with him inside that chair and they have a kid together who later grows up and tries to sell the chair to a pretty girl so she'd marry him and live with him inside that chair just like how his parents did. Why did they pick this name? I don't know tbh.

    • @thorleif8872
      @thorleif8872 3 ปีที่แล้ว +5

      Holy shit, they changed the novel a lot. In the original the women receives a letter with the story of a chair maker who is living inside a couch (his masterpiece) in a hotel, he listen to people, make them comfortable....and robs them at night. After a while the hotel decided to throw out the couch (with the man inside) and sell it. The couch goes to a woman who loves and writes novels, the man describes everything...the woman, her husband, how she lives etc....the woman is scared af but recives another letter from the same man who mentioned that the first letter was just a manuscript for a new book of his, the human chair.

    • @lauraraymakers3122
      @lauraraymakers3122 3 ปีที่แล้ว +18

      It's not as much a dialect as such they sing in, its more Classical Japanese. Their lyrics use the language from the Edo era and even quote directly from literature, which indeed most modern Japanese would have difficulty with. It would be like listening to Middle English for us.

    @Tadakatsu 3 ปีที่แล้ว

    Just a hard working band that was unfortunately stuck in the underground for decades. They live in a really rural region of Japan which doesn't have a big music scene and is far away from Japan's main musical hubs of Tokyo and Osaka. Shinji Wajima and Kenichi Suzuki worked at their local post office until only a few years ago, making just enough to keep their musical career/hobby going. In the early 2010s they started to get shared around online quite a bit and it finally helped to boost their career to the heights they honestly deserved way earlier. They're shockingly consistent and haven't made a bad album despite a pretty long run.
